Zusammenfassung: | Highlights • We review control strategies of gait rehabilitation robots. • Assist-as-needed controls are popular in research, thus discussed in details. • Related clinical trials are reviewed from the control viewpoint. • Studies are yet to prove any specific control strategy is superior to the others. • Biofeedback and kinetic assessments will facilitate further control development. |
